Well, 'feel good kids story' often have themes like friendship, kindness, and perseverance. For instance, 'The Velveteen Rabbit' tells about the power of love. A little boy's love makes the rabbit real in a sense. Then there's 'Stuart Little'. Stuart, despite being small, has big adventures and shows great courage. Also, 'Winnie - the - Pooh' stories are full of simple joys and the strong bond between the characters.
Well, 'Winnie - the - Pooh' is a classic 'feel good kids story'. The simple and gentle tales of Pooh Bear and his friends in the Hundred Acre Wood, like their search for honey or helping each other out, are full of warmth. 'The Velveteen Rabbit' is another. It tells the story of a toy rabbit that becomes real through the love of a child. Then there's 'Corduroy', about a little bear in a department store who just wants to find a home and a friend.
In some cities, people organized balcony concerts during the lockdown. They played music, sang songs, and it was a beautiful way of uniting and bringing some joy to the otherwise gloomy days of the coronavirus pandemic. Everyone participated with enthusiasm, and it became a symbol of hope and togetherness.
